Block

#20,571,663
Block Number
20,571,663 @ 01/07/2025, 10:21:10
Status
Finalized
ID
0x0139e60fbfe344cb5610f3db6a9a204b5eeba9828199ac31cbaa8b4ac51f012d
Transactions
Gas Used
696157/39843942 (1.75% Used)
Total Score
2,008,252,488 (+98)
Rewards
2.83 VTHO